KEYS ON 5/11 AT 1PM Re: NEW ENERGY RATING ON WHITEGOODS 5May 14, 2010 4:18 pm bluesteel No camy, its just a more stringent system encouraging even more energy efficiency - so what was 4 stars is about 2.5 and what was 2 stars (which should not really be manufactured) is now 1/2 or no stars. Anything more than 6 as said previously is super efficient. I was a bit deflated when all our 4 star appliances downgraded to 2 So the more stars the more energy efficient as before - if you get 4 stars in the new system that is very good.
